The maximal destabilizers for Chow and K-stability

Abstract

Donaldson showed that the constant scalar curvature Kähler metrics can be quantized by the balanced Hermitian norms on the spaces of global sections. We explore an analogous problem in the unstable situation. For a K-unstable manifold (X,L), its projective embedding via |kL| will be Chow-unstable when k is sufficiently large and divisible. There is a unique filtration on H0(X,kL), that corresponds to the maximal destabilizer for Chow-stability of the embedded variety. On the other hand, there is a maximal destabilizer for K-stability after the work of Xia and Li, which corresponds to the steepest descent direction of K-energy. Based on Boucksom-Jonsson's non-Archimedean pluripotential theory and some idealistic assumptions, we provide a route to show that maximal K-destabilizers are quantized by the maximal Chow-destabilizers.
